Chicago St. Patrick's Day Parade

March 2014 (CHICAGO)

Everyone's Irish on St. Patrick's Day -- and ABC 7 Chicago continued the celebration of a grand Chicago tradition with the 31st annual broadcast of the St. Patrick's Day Parade which will air on ABC 7.

ABC 7's meteorologist Mike Caplan, reporter Frank Mathie, former ABC 7 Anchor Joel Daly and Roseann Finnegan LeFevour, Midwest director of the American Ireland Fund teamed up to host the coverage of bagpipers, floats, marching bands and marching politicians that make this one of the most celebrated events in Chicago each year.

The 2014 St. Patrick's Day Parade Grand Marshal was none other than Chicago Blackhawks President and CEO, John McDonough, who is credited for being responsible for one of sports' biggest success stories. The Guest of Honor for the parade is Father Gavin Quinn, Chaplain, Chicago and Cook County Building Trades Council.

Thousands of marchers, parade units, marching bands, floats, horses and a few leprechauns were featured as the parade proceeds from Balbo Drive, north on Columbus Drive to Monroe Street. Always a must-see in the parade, the Shannon Rovers bagpipers bring a touch of Ireland to Chicago as they have for the past 88 years.

Once again this year, ABC 7 Chicago's float featuring Tanja Babich, Stacey Baca, Tracy Butler, Steve Dolinsky, Mark Giangreco, Evelyn Holmes and Phil Schwarz, was part of the St. Patrick's Day Parade tradition.
